Seeking Director of Spiritual Engagement

Beth Emeth Bais Yehuda Synagogue (BEBY) a large, traditional synagogue in Toronto is seeking a dynamic professional to serve as Director of Spiritual Engagement. BEBY is seeking to grow and maintain a welcoming, vibrant and meaningful Jewish experience for young professionals and the over 25 age cohort.

As Director of Spiritual Engagement (DSE), of Beth Emeth Bais Yehuda (“BEBY” or the “Synagogue”) you will develop and implement social, educational, spiritual, religious and ritual programming for the Synagogue in a manner that is sensitive to the needs of the congregation, with an emphasis on the 25 – 45 age cohort. You will be a role model to the congregation and the Jewish community at large, in terms of traditional religious observance, “derech eretz” and community involvement.
